Description

Main Tasks and Objectives

  • To maintain data on the HR and payroll database including input of starters, leavers and employee and organisational changes and to ensure data is timely and accurate and in line with data protection legislation.
  • To maintain professional electronic and paper records to satisfy procedures and statutory requirements. To regularly review the records to ensure that they are accurate and up to date and in line with data protection requirements.
  • To support HRM in recruitment activities for the business to ensure the required headcount is achieved and high quality staff are employed within agreed budgets to meet the needs of the business.
  • To assist the HRM in providing a comprehensive HR advisory service to all Company managers and staff to ensure that the Company follows best practice in the management of its staff and to ensure compliance with legal requirements.
  • To provide effective communication to managers and staff in conjunction with the HRM.
  • To advise managers and staff on all aspects of terms and conditions.
  • To manage the process with regards to flexible working changes when requests are received by the business and at all agreed review stages (normally 3 month's trial period and annual review). To ensure that all requests are dealt with in a timely manner and ensure that appropriate communication occurs at all stages.
  • To maintain individual sickness absence records and monthly Company records to produce management information aimed at reducing sickness levels within the Company.
  • To assist managers in counselling employees to improve their overall attendance levels; to endeavour to achieve the company target of 2% or less each financial year.
  • To take the lead on maternity/shared parental leave/paternity/adoption and flexible working matters, ensuring records are maintained and annual reviews carried out.
  • To undertake disciplinary hearings as the HR representative for all attendance and timekeeping issues and any other issues that occur by agreement with the HRM in line with the Company's policy and the ACAS code.
  • To undertake grievance hearings as the HR representative by agreement with the HRM and to aim to guide the line managers through the process to satisfactory conclusion; both meeting the needs of the Company and the individual in line with the Company's policy and the ACAS code.
  • To administer the probation process and records and deal with performance issues as they arise; keeping the HRM informed on a monthly basis and to advise the HRM when a salary change is required.
  • To administer the Company pension schemes and ensure correct contributions are deducted each month. To liaise with the HRM/payroll agency and financial advisers as required. To act as the first point of contact for pension queries and ensure autoenrolment legislation requirements are met. To arrange for any advisor visits as and when required. To ensure that all TPR declarations are completed in a timely manner.
  • To administer the private health scheme for the Company including starters, leavers and changes ensuring data is correct and up to date for the annual renewal process and for the P11d submission. To monitor the claims information to ensure the business is aware of the status of the scheme, on a monthly basis, until conclusion in the scheme year and ready for the renewal each year.
  • To administer the expenses system (Concur) including inputting starters, leavers and changes and produce reports where necessary. Also be a point of contact for expenses queries. To liaise with the Account Manager/Financial Controller as and when necessary to escalate any issues out of HRO's control.
  • To undertake exit interviews for voluntary leavers of the business to understand the reasons for leaving and communicate to the relevant parties for appropriate action to be taken.
  • To be responsible for the administration of the payroll each month:
  • To be the key point of contact for receipt of payroll information from the management team within the business.
  • To input payroll data into the payroll system in an accurate and timely manner, meeting the payroll deadlines agreed with the payroll management service.
  • To advise and guide managers and verify the authorisation process of the selfservice system.
  • To liaise with the payroll management service to ensure that information is collated in a timely manner to meet payroll deadlines.
  • To undertake CIS verifications, online submissions and provide individual statements each month.
  • To provide line managers with payroll information as appropriate to assist with cost management especially in relation to overtime.
  • To agree the payroll with the HR manager, Financial Controller and Finance Director each month and instruct the commit to the payroll management service provider on time for the payments to be made to each individual by the pay date each month.
